If you are going to store passkeys in a password manager, the whole situation is no more secure than just using passwords.
Consider:
1. Password managers tie passwords to sites, so phishing-resistance is achieved.
2. Password managers allow long, complicated, individual password per web site, so compromise blast radius is 1.
